Installation and commissioning
The machine should be connected to a 480V, 3-phase, 60Hz power supply via a 32A wall-mounted isolator. Additionally, a compressed air supply of 3 to 5 bar is required.

Warranty
The warranty period for goods is within 3 years from the date of BL/AWB for any breakage, damage, or defects caused by the quality of the Goods or for reasons attributable to the Seller.
In the event that the Goods need to be repaired or replaced within the warranty period, the execution time shall be the minimum reasonable time required, starting from the date mutually agreed upon by the Buyer and Seller.
However, the Seller shall be relieved of its obligations under this Warranty to the extent that:
-
The Buyer has modified the machines;
-
The damage to the Goods has occurred during transit or is due to improper storage, unloading, handling, or operation by the Buyer;
-
The Buyer has failed to handle, install, operate, and maintain the Goods strictly in accordance with the Seller’s instruction manual;
-
Additionally, wear and tear parts are excluded from the warranty.
In the case of a turnkey project, the warranty will commence once the installation is completed.

Mandrel
– Maintains the shape of the profile: prevent it from rippling or deforming during the bending process.
– Mandrels perform better than fillers for thin-walled tubes or profiles
– Supports tight bends: For narrow angles or special designs, the mandrel helps preserve the shape and strength of the profile.

What is an Aluminium Extrusion 4 Roller Bending Machine?
It is a CNC-controlled machine designed to bend aluminium profiles with high precision. It uses four rollers, including movable tall tool shafts, to achieve a wide bending range and accommodate complex shapes.
What profile sizes can this machine handle?
It can handle profiles from 1/4″ to 2 1/2″ in height and 6mm to 60mm in width.
How easy is it to operate the machine?
With Smart CNC and intuitive bending software, users can learn to operate the machine within one hour.
Can I upload my CAD drawings for bending?
Yes, the machine supports DXF and STEP file imports. Bending can be initiated within 60 seconds of uploading.
Is it servo electric or hydraulic?
The machine comes in Servo Electric or Hybrid Servo Hydraulic versions for clean, low-noise, energy-efficient operation.
